    Tailwater Trout on the Cumberland River with Hagan Wonn, Cumberland Troutfitters

    Tailwater Trout on the Cumberland River with Hagan Wonn, Cumberland Troutfitters

    Our destination is the Cumberland River tailwater near Jamestown, Kentucky.  Our guest is expert fly fishing guide Hagan Wonn, owner of Cumberland Troutfitters.   For many of us, Kentucky and trout fishing doesn’t exactly spring to mind … unless you’ve fished the Cumberland River below Wolf Creek dam.  Here you will find a large and uncrowded tailwater system and world-class trout fishing. 

    A self-described fishing bum, Hagan grew up in Kentucky and started guiding at age 19.  Known around Lexington as the kid with “a fishing problem”, Hagan started guiding clients with an Old Town Canoe and shares some funny stories about that.  Hagan has a forestry degree from the University of Montana, where he studied and guided his way through college. He’s been fishing the Cumberland River for over 20 years now and has been featured in a number of fly fishing publications and outdoor programs.  

    Bonus:  nearby Hatchery Creek, known for highly technical fishing and big fall migratory rainbows, up to 30”!

    047 Mo Hagan - What Will Group Fitness Look Like in 2021

    047 Mo Hagan - What Will Group Fitness Look Like in 2021

    A global ambassador on the benefits of exercise and living well, Maureen Hagan is vice president of program innovation for GoodLife Fitness and canfitpro – Canadian Fitness Professionals — the largest fitness education and certification organization in Canada.

    Mo, as she is known in the fitness industry, is a licensed physiotherapist, a Physical Health Educator and has been recognized for her work in fitness that spans three decades, with numerous awards for innovation, passion and leadership and, was named as one of Canada ’s 20 Most Influential Women in Sport and Physical Activity in 2014.

    Most recently, Mo was acknowledged by IHRSA with the ‘Woman Leader Award’ in honor of Julie Main. Mo is a published author and a regular contributor to consumer magazines and on-line publications including the Huffington Post.

    In this week's show, the focus is on Group Fitness. We look at what group fitness might look like in 5 years time, what the instructor of 2021 should aim for and Mo gives us her top tips on preparing ourselves for group fitness in the future.
